2005 GMC Envoy vs. 2003 Kia Sorento

To start off, 2005 GMC Envoy is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2003 Kia Sorento.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2003 Kia Sorento would be higher. At 4,163 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 GMC Envoy is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 GMC Envoy (275 HP) has 83 more horse power than 2003 Kia Sorento. (192 HP). In normal driving conditions, 2005 GMC Envoy should accelerate faster than 2003 Kia Sorento.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 GMC Envoy weights approximately 267 kg more than 2003 Kia Sorento.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 GMC Envoy (373 Nm) has 63 more torque (in Nm) than 2003 Kia Sorento. (310 Nm). This means 2005 GMC Envoy will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2003 Kia Sorento.

Compare all specifications:

2005 GMC Envoy 2003 Kia Sorento
Make GMC Kia
Model Envoy Sorento
Year Released 2005 2003
Body Type SUV SUV
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 4163 cc 3489 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 275 HP 192 HP
Torque 373 Nm 310 Nm
Engine Bore Size 93.1 mm 93 mm
Engine Stroke Size 102 mm 85.8 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 10.0:1 10.0:1
Drive Type 4WD 4WD
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 2257 kg 1990 kg
Vehicle Length 5300 mm 4500 mm
Vehicle Width 1880 mm 1840 mm
Vehicle Height 1850 mm 1710 mm
Wheelbase Size 3280 mm 2670 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 95 L 80 L
